#CreatorPad "According to the U.S. Department of State, the pilot program will officially take effect on August 20, lasting for one year and applicable to applicants for non-immigrant visas of type B-1 (business) and B-2 (tourism). In a new move to tighten immigration policy, the U.S. announced it will implement a pilot program requiring visa applicants for tourism or business from certain countries to deposit an amount of up to 15,000 USD to prevent visa overstays, an issue considered a national security threat."
